The article "Students Increasingly Turn to Credit Cards" (San Luis Obispo Tribune, July 21, 2006)reported that 37% of college freshmen and 48% of col- lege seniors carry a credit card balance from month to month. Suppose that the reported percentages  were based on random samples of 1000 college freshmen and 1000 college seniors.

a. Construct a 90% confidence interval for the propor- tion of college freshmen who carry a credit card bal- ance from month to month.

b. Construct a 90% confidence interval for the propor- tion of college seniors who carry a credit card bal- ance from month to month.

c. Explain why the two 90% confidence intervals from Parts (a) and (b) are not the same width.
